QUESTION NO: 1
A 28-year-old woman presented to the emergency department with a 3-day history of abdominal pain. Her past medical history included intermenstrual bleeding, and she was undergoing
6-monthly renal ultrasound surveillance for a cystic lesion.
Investigations:
serum creatinine84 umol/L (60-110)
serum corrected calcium3.20 mmol/L (2.20-2.60)
serum phosphate0.7 mmol/L (0.8-1.4)
plasma parathyroid hormone19.5 pmol/L (0.9-5.4)
What is the most likely condition underlying the clinical presentation?
A. Cowden's syndrome
B. hyperparathyroidism-jaw tumour syndrome
C. multiple endocrine neoplasia type 1
D. multiple endocrine neoplasia type 2B
E. von Hippel-Lindau syndrome
Answer: B

QUESTION NO: 2
A 17-year-old boy, with short stature, obesity and neurobehavioural problems, was referred because of cold intolerance.
On examination, he and his mother had similar body habitus and short fingers (brachydactyly).
Investigations (before attending clinic):
serum sodium143 mmol/L (137-144) serum potassium4.4 mmol/L (3.5-4.9) serum creatinine93 umol/L (60-110) serum corrected calcium2.02 mmol/L (2.20-2.60) serum phosphate1.7 mmol/L (0.8-
1.4)
serum thyroid-stimulating hormone16.0 mU/L (0.4-5.0) serum free T410.0 pmol/L (10.0-22.0) plasma parathyroid hormone27.0 pmol/L (0.9-5.4)
His mother's blood tests were all normal.
What is the most likely diagnosis in this boy?
A. DiGeorge syndrome
B. McCune-Albright syndrome
C. polyglandular autoimmune syndrome type 1
D. pseudohypoparathyroidism
E. pseudopseudohypoparathyroidism
Answer: D

QUESTION NO: 3
A 75-year-old woman presented with a 4-week history of lethargy. Her medical history was unremarkable and she took no medication.
On examination, her blood pressure was 140/70 mmHg lying. She was euvolaemic.
Investigations:
serum sodium120 mmol/L (137-144)
serum potassium3.8 mmol/L (3.5-4.9)
serum urea3.0 mmol/L (2.5-7.0)
serum creatinine75 umol/L (60-110)
short tetracosactide (Synacthen@) test (250 micrograms):
baseline serum cortisol450 nmol/L (200-700)
serum cortisol (30 min after tetracosactide)600 nmol/L (>550)
serum thyroid-stimulating hormone2.5 mU/L (0.4-5.0)
serum free T416.9 pmol/L (10.0-22.0)
urinary sodium70 mmol/L
What is the most appropriate initial management?
A. demeclocycline
B. fluid restriction
C. hydrocortisone
D. intravenous sodium chloride 0.9%
E. tolvaptan
Answer: B

QUESTION NO: 4
A 72-year-old woman was referred for bone density assessment after sustaining a fracture of her right ankle after a minor fall. She had previously fractured her right wrist after tripping in the street. Her past medical history included occasional angina relieved by glyceryl trinitrate spray and a previous deep venous thrombosis. Her medication comprised aspirin, simvastatin, alendronic acid, and calcium and vitamin D, which she had been taking regularly for 2 years.
Investigations:
DXA scan of spine (L2-L4)T score -2.4
DXA scan of total hipT score -2.8
What is the most appropriate treatment?
A. continue alendronic acid
B. switch alendronic acid to pamidronate
C. switch alendronic acid to raloxifene
D. switch alendronic acid to strontium ranelate
E. switch alendronic acid to teriparatide
Answer: A

QUESTION NO: 5
A 30-year-old man was reviewed in the diabetes clinic. He had type 1 diabetes mellitus of 6 months' duration, treated with subcutaneous insulin in a basal bolus regimen (short-acting insulin three times daily; long-acting insulin once daily).
Investigations:
haemoglobin A1c52 mmol/mol (20-42)
At what arterialised venous blood glucose threshold would a patient typically expect to develop neuroglycopenic symptoms?
A. <2.3 mmol/L
B. 2.3-2.6 mmol/L
C. 2.7-3.0 mmol/L
D. 3.1-3.4 mmol/L
E. 3.5-3.9 mmol/L
Answer: C
